हैं दश्त अब ये जीते बस्ते थे शहर सारे
वीरान-ए-कुहन है मामूरा इस जहाँ का
— Mir Taqi Mir
Meaning
Now these deserts are the places where the whole city once lived; the world is a ruin, O lord of this world.
Explanation
Mir Taqi Mir uses powerful imagery to describe the decline of civilization. He suggests that the vibrant life and culture once found in grand cities have retreated. Now, the wilderness (the deserts) seems more alive than the once-great urban centers. The entire world, in his poignant view, is caught in a state of ancient ruin—a profound meditation on the transient nature of human achievement and the inevitable passage of time.
